Output 4a3963d0e77929bc88b6f27b02f4eb25788f66cc083137dd86d114158392938a:3

value
56952649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43f175e1688cac20d8f384c620ba71631c36174 OP_EQUAL
address
MTFR4ksQuA4HWYnYjKzLMCPs3AYNjoaqj7
transaction
4a3963d0e77929bc88b6f27b02f4eb25788f66cc083137dd86d114158392938a
spent
true